- [Instructor] Now that we know why we would use hub sites and who can create them, let's walk through how to set up and configure a hub site. To set up a hub site, you'll need to go to the Office 365 admin center. From here, navigate to the SharePoint admin center. In the left hand side, you'll see an active sites button, click that. This will show a listing of all the active sites in your SharePoint environment. From here, we could look through this list and create a hub site based on one of the existing sites we have or we can create a new site and make that a hub. In this case, I want to make one of my existing sites a hub site. Find the site that you want to make a hub and click the checkmark next to it. You'll notice an option for hub site in the menu. You have two options. To register as a hub site or associate with a hub site. In this case, I want to register my HR site as a new hub site. To register as a hub, we'll need to give this hub a name.
